Gallery 4 - Deanna by Nature

Balance - Canadian Goose 1335

Balance is the key. Work/Play, Saving/Spending, Awake/Sleep,
Family/Friends/Alone. Balance.
Spiritual Meaning of Goose - Find happiness and joy in the small things. This will help you move through any emotional turbulent waters with ease. Goose will assist you in letting things go that are not beneficial to you.

